Early Roots and Inspirations

Stamets’ fascination with mushrooms sprouted in his childhood days spent wandering the forests of Ohio. His insatiable curiosity for these mysterious organisms ignited a lifelong passion for mycology. His experiences in nature laid the groundwork for what would become a pioneering career dedicated to unlocking the secrets of fungi.

The journey into mycology led Stamets to the Evergreen State College in Olympia, Washington, where he immersed himself in the study of fungi. His quest for knowledge and innovation soon bore fruit, propelling him into the spotlight of mycological research.

Pioneering Mycological Contributions

Stamets’ career is marked by numerous groundbreaking contributions to mycology. He is known for his research into mycelium, the intricate network of fungal threads that forms the vegetative part of fungi. His work spans a spectrum of applications, from the use of mycelium in bioremediation—where fungi aid in environmental cleanup—to enhancing agricultural yields by improving soil health through mycelial networks.

Among his significant contributions is his advocacy for the lion’s mane mushroom’s potential in stimulating nerve growth factor (NGF) production, hinting at its possible role in treating neurodegenerative conditions. Stamets’ relentless pursuit of mycological exploration has unveiled a world of possibilities in harnessing fungi for ecological and medicinal purposes.

Eco-Warrior and Environmental Advocate

Stamets’ reverence for fungi extends to their role in environmental sustainability. He has championed the concept of mycoremediation, harnessing the power of mushrooms to clean up environmental pollutants. His visionary approach involves using fungi to break down toxic substances, offering a natural and eco-friendly solution to environmental challenges like oil spills and soil contamination.

Advocacy for Psychedelics and Consciousness Exploration

Beyond his mycological endeavors, Stamets has emerged as a prominent advocate for the therapeutic potential of psychedelics, particularly psilocybin-containing mushrooms. His advocacy aligns with a growing body of research suggesting the positive impact of psychedelics in treating mental health conditions such as depression, anxiety, and PTSD. Through his advocacy efforts, Stamets emphasizes the need for responsible and guided usage of psychedelics in therapeutic settings. He envisions a future where these substances facilitate profound introspection, emotional healing, and personal growth under professional supervision.

Fascinating Quotes and Trivia

Stamets’ wisdom and insights on mushrooms, psychedelics, and nature have been shared through various platforms, leaving a trail of memorable quotes and fascinating trivia:

Myco-Insights: “Mycelium is the neurological network of nature. Interlacing mosaics of mycelium infuse habitats with information-sharing membranes. These membranes are aware, react to change, and collectively have the long-term health of the host environment in mind.” – Paul Stamets

Mushroom Magic: “Nature is a force of coherence, of harmony. It’s always best to use nature’s methodology because it’s tried, true, and it’s beautiful.” – Paul Stamets

Psychedelic Potential: “What I think we’re going to find is that psilocybin and neurogenesis have a pathway in terms of being able to increase cognitive function and understanding.” – Paul Stamets

These profound statements reflect Stamets’ deep understanding of the interconnectedness of nature and his visionary outlook on the potential of mushrooms and psychedelics.
